标题 | 工业CGI现场监控系统设计 |
范文 | 孙在尚+李庆达+米热班古丽 【摘要】 为了实现对工厂环境监控信息的事实传输,提出了一種基于STM32F103系列单片机的工业CGI现场监控系统设计方案,并完成系统的软硬件设计。该系统的硬件部分主留有多种通信方式接口封装,软件部分采用C语言进行编程,能够完成对工业环境的实时监控数据进行传输。实际应用表明,该系统具有操作简便、抗干扰能力强的特点。 【关键词】 工业CGI STM32F103系列 C语言 单片机 一、系统功能及智能网关部分功能概述 系统要求监测的工厂环境信息和连接的PLC设备运行信息能够及时的上传到手持终端或电脑终端,通过手持终端或电脑客户端能够实时了解受监控设备的运行状态并能够对一些实时性要求不太强、不影响生产过程的简单操作进行控制。选用的芯片以及其他硬件设备具有可靠地稳定性,下层节点具有适应严酷环境的能力(宽泛的温度适应域,90%以上的空气湿度,可靠地抗电磁干扰能力)。为了适应严酷环境,提高系统稳定性,系统主控芯片采用STM32F103系列。为提高系统的开放性及兼容性,下层设计成分层式,智能网关只负责数据流向,不再负责数据处理,节点负责数据处理。为了更好地适应工厂环境,通讯方式可选网线,485,ZIGBEE等,只能网关留有统一的接口,通讯方式封装到板卡上,直接插到网关上。 二、系统硬件设计 2.1硬件架构与要求 经过充分的调研,我们发现工业现场环境严酷,为提高系统的稳定性和适应严酷环境的能力。系统需要宽泛的温度适应域。在90%以上的空气湿度(无凝水现象)的环境中,系统能可靠稳定的工作。另外系统还要有可靠地抗电磁干扰能力和抗振动能力。 为了提高系统的抗干扰能力(雷击、过电压、过电流),系统需进行避雷、防过压过流设计。为确保系统高可靠性运行,减少故障的发生,系统主控芯片采用STM32F103系列或飞思卡尔K60系列。工厂设备间通信协议多且复杂的特点,且一般PLC都支持MODBUS协议,为了通信统一,整个系统的通信协议都采用MODBUS 协议。为了兼容其他没有采用MODBUS协议的设备,需制作一协议转换模块,将其他通信协议转化为MODBUS协议。为了更好地适应工厂环境,通讯方式可选网线、485、ZIGBEE等多种通信方式以提高系统的开放性及兼容性。 2.2硬件设计 系统硬件主要由主控部分、电源部分、通信接口部分组成。 2.2.1主控部分 1、主控芯片 ARM公司的高性能”Cortex-M3”内核,1.25DMips/ MHz,而ARM7TDMI只有0.95DMips/MHz,一流的外设, 1μs的双12位ADC,4兆位/秒的UART,18兆位/秒的SPI,18MHz的I/O翻转速度,低功耗,在72MHz时消耗36mA(所有外设处于工作状态),待机时下降到2μA,最大的集成度,复位电路、低电压检测、调压器、精确的RC振荡器等,简单的结构和易用的工具,STM32F10x参数,2V-3.6V供电,容忍5V的I/O管脚,优异的安全时钟模式,带唤醒功能的低功耗模式,内部RC振荡器,内嵌复位电路,工作温度范围:,-40℃至+85℃或105℃,STM32F101性能,36MHz CPU多达16K字节SRAM 1x12位ADC温度传感器。 2.2.2电源部分 系统采用24伏稳压直流电源供电。系统设有三个接线端口,分别链接外部电源的正负电极和大地。在总电源电源电路中接入压敏电阻,压敏电阻具有很好的防雷、过压保护作用。智能网关主控需要3.3伏电源,通信模块需要5伏电源。为提高系统的可靠性和稳点性,通信模块和主控模块分开供电。分别采用两个功率分别为2W和14W的DC/DC电源降压模块将24伏电源降压到5伏给主控和通信模块供电。DC/ DC电源降压模块具有体积小、功耗小、电压稳定、精度高、抗干扰能力强等特点,更重要的是DC/DC电源降压模块隔离保护后续电路的作用。将功率为2W的DC/DC电源降压模块降压得到的5伏电源用LM1117芯片转3.3伏后给主控芯片供电。将功率为14W的DC/DC电源降压模块降压得到的 5伏电源给通信模块供电。 2.2.3通信接口部分 主板板上共有四个并联的接口每个接口上有地址线、网卡接口、485接口和ZigBee。每个端口均可插入任何通讯接口,每个接口同时只允许一种接口插入,根据需要临时插入即可使用。 通信接口和主控之间通过光电耦合链接。 系统接口输入输出外设采用USR-TCP232-T以太网—串口模块,该模块能将TCP网络数据包或UDP数据包与RS232接口数据实现透明传输,网络转串口模块 USRTCP232-T是连接串口设备到网络的桥梁,借助此模块,可以轻松实现设备联网管理和控制功能。 三、软件架构与要求 3.1智能网关系统软件运行结构图 四、 结论 该工业CGI现场监控系统采用具有高数据数据处理的能力,软件设计采用模块化设计思想,提高了系统的可靠性和维护性。系统具备可靠地抗电磁干扰能力和抗振动能力。 实际测试表明该测试系统具有稳定可靠、使用简单等特点,达到了设计要求。 |
随便看 |
|
科学优质学术资源、百科知识分享平台,免费提供知识科普、生活经验分享、中外学术论文、各类范文、学术文献、教学资料、学术期刊、会议、报纸、杂志、工具书等各类资源检索、在线阅读和软件app下载服务。